为了账号安全,请及时绑定邮箱和手机立即绑定
慕课网数字资源数据库体验端
JavaScript进阶篇_学习笔记_慕课网
为了账号安全,请及时绑定邮箱和手机立即绑定

JavaScript进阶篇

慕课官方号 页面重构设计
难度入门
时长 8小时55分
  • 我测试不需要var int= 这段字符,其实主要的作用是获取当前时间(程序运行的一瞬间),将时间现在输入框中,打开页面时,解析头部就会自动调用setInterval(clock,2000)这个函数,具体原因不清楚,应该是初始化调用吧,于我们自定义的不太一样。
    查看全部
  • //通过javascript的日期对象来得到当前的日期,并输出。 var date=new Date(); //document.write(date); var weekDay = "星期" + "日一二三四五六".split("")[date.getDay()]; document.write(date.getFullYear()+"年"+date.getMonth()+"月"+date.getDate()+"日"+"&nbsp" +weekDay+"<br/>") //成绩是一长窜的字符串不好处理,找规律后分割放到数组里更好操作哦 var scoreStr = "小明:87;小花:81;小红:97;小天:76;小张:74;小小:94;小西:90;小伍:76;小迪:64;小曼:76"; var scorearr=scoreStr.split(';'); var sum=0; //从数组中将成绩撮出来,然后求和取整,并输出。 for(var i=0;i<scorearr.length;i++){ var score=parseInt(scorearr[i].toString().substr(3,2)); sum+=score; } document.write( sum+"<br/>");
    查看全部
    0 采集 收起 来源:编程练习

    2018-03-22

  • location用于获取或设置窗体的URL,并且可以用于解析URL。 语法: location.[属性|方法]
    查看全部
    0 采集 收起 来源:Location对象

    2015-07-22

  • var weekDay = "星期" + "日一二三四五六".split("")[new Date().getDay()]; alert(weekDay); 获取当前系统日期是周几
    查看全部
    0 采集 收起 来源:编程练习

    2018-03-22

  • setTimeout()和clearTimeout()一起使用,停止计时器。 语法: clearTimeout(id_of_setTimeout)
    查看全部
  • <script type="text/javascript"> var mya1= new Array("hello!") var mya2= new Array("I","love"); var mya3= new Array("JavaScript","!"); var mya4=mya1.concat(mya2,mya3); document.write(mya4); </script> 连接三个数组
    查看全部
  • 首先创建节点:newnode=document.createElement("元素"); 赋值: 插入:appendChild(newnode)
    查看全部
  • 用 function 定义的函数是不被执行的,函数只有在遇到函数调用时才会执行。
    查看全部
  • 加载事件(onload) 事件会在页面加载完成后,立即发生,同时执行被调用的程序。 注意:1. 加载页面时,触发onload事件,事件写在<body>标签内。 2. 此节的加载页面,可理解为打开一个新页面时。 如下代码,当加载一个新页面时,弹出对话框“加载中,请稍等…”。
    查看全部
  • 卸载事件(onunload) 当用户退出页面时(页面关闭、页面刷新等),触发onUnload事件,同时执行被调用的程序。 注意:不同浏览器对onunload事件支持不同。
    查看全部
  • 加载事件(onload) 事件会在页面加载完成后,立即发生,同时执行被调用的程序。 注意:1. 加载页面时,触发onload事件,事件写在<body>标签内。 <body onload="message()"></body> <script> function message(){ alert("加载中,请稍后!"); } </script>
    查看全部
  • 文本框内容改变事件(onchange) 通过改变文本框的内容来触发onchange事件,同时执行被调用的程序。 <textarea name="summary" cols="60" rows="5" onchange="message()">请写入个人简介,不少于200字!</textarea> <script type="text/javascript"> function message(){ alert("您改变了文本内容!"); } </script>
    查看全部
  • 内容选中事件(onselect) 选中事件,当文本框或者文本域中的文字被选中时,触发onselect事件,同时调用的程序就会被执行。 <textarea name="summary" cols="60" rows="5" onselect="message()">请写入个人简介,不少于200字!</textarea> </form> <script> function message(){ alert("您触发了选中事件!"); } </script>
    查看全部
  • 失焦事件(onblur) onblur事件与onfocus是相对事件,当光标离开当前获得聚焦对象的时候,触发onblur事件,同时执行被调用的程序。 <input name="password" type="text" value="请输入密码!" onblur="message()" > <script type="text/javascript"> function message(){ alert("请确定已输入密码后,在移开!"); } </script>
    查看全部
  • 光标聚焦事件(onfocus) 当网页中的对象获得聚点时,执行onfocus调用的程序就会被执行。 <select onfocus="message()"> <option>学生</option> <option>教师</option> <option>工程师</option> <option>演员</option> <option>会计</option> </select> <script> function message(){ alert(请选择您现在的职业!); } </script>
    查看全部

举报

0/150
提交
取消
课程须知
你需要具备HTML、css基础知识,建议同学们也可以想学习下js入门篇,快速认识js,熟悉js基本语法,更加快速入手进阶篇!
老师告诉你能学到什么?
通过JavaScript学习,掌握基本语法,制作简单交互式页面
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!